Got rear ended by an off-duty cop
I was driving home from work today, and while waiting to turn right onto a main street a saw that a full size chevy pick up was pulling up quickly behind me. He hit hard, the first thing that went through my mind was my exhaust, but he only hit me with his front lisence plate frame on the drivers side of my lisence plate. It made a 3" crack in the cover and pushed the whole thing in about 1/4". The first thing he asked was if i really wanted to call the police. My first thoughts, he just doesn't want a ticket, then he told me he was a cop and i knew he didn't want one of his buddies to come and laugh at him. We swapped information and i was one my way. You should contact your insurance company ASAP if you have not already done so. You may want to find out if you can still file a police accident report. The cop knows that it will be harder to blame him without an accident report - you should have called the cops when it happened.
